Li Pinglan: Weaver of Landscapes and Cultural Echoes
Li Pinglan, born in Beijing in 1985, is a Chinese artist whose distinctive approach to textile art—primarily silk—has garnered international acclaim. Her canvases aren’t merely surfaces adorned with pigment; they are immersive explorations of the natural world interwoven with threads of cultural heritage and personal identity. From her early training through her ongoing artistic practice, Li Pinglan's journey has been marked by a profound engagement with both tradition and innovation.- Early Influences: Li Pinglan’s formative years were steeped in the rich artistic traditions of Beijing, exposing her to calligraphy, painting, and ceramics—disciplines that instilled a meticulous attention to detail and an appreciation for symbolic representation. These influences subtly permeate her later works, particularly evident in her deliberate use of color palettes reminiscent of classical Chinese landscapes.
- Technique & Material Exploration: Li Pinglan’s mastery lies in her skillful manipulation of silk—a material deeply rooted in Chinese history and culture. She employs techniques ranging from batik to weaving to dyeing, transforming raw silk into breathtaking compositions that capture the essence of natural scenes. Her meticulous layering of colors and textures creates a tactile experience for the viewer, mirroring the layered complexities of cultural narratives.
- Notable Works: Among her most celebrated pieces is “Olive Wish,” a stunning silk painting depicting olive groves bathed in golden light—a visual meditation on resilience and beauty amidst adversity. This artwork exemplifies Li Pinglan’s ability to distill profound themes into deceptively simple forms, resonating with viewers across cultures.
- Exhibitions & Recognition: Li Pinglan's work has been showcased in prestigious galleries and museums throughout China and internationally, cementing her position as a leading voice in contemporary textile art. Her exhibitions have garnered critical acclaim for their artistic merit and intellectual depth.
The Significance of Landscape Representation
Li Pinglan’s fascination with landscape stems from the enduring legacy of Chinese painting traditions—specifically shan shui (“mountain water”), which prioritizes capturing atmospheric perspective and conveying emotional resonance. Unlike Western landscapes that often strive for realism, shan shui seeks to evoke a sense of sublime beauty and contemplation. Li Pinglan skillfully adapts these principles to her silk canvases, prioritizing tonal harmony and compositional balance to convey the spirit of nature.- Symbolism & Narrative: Beyond mere visual depiction, Li Pinglan imbues her paintings with symbolic elements drawn from Chinese folklore and mythology. These symbols enrich the narrative dimension of her artworks, inviting viewers to engage in a dialogue about themes such as harmony, balance, and the interconnectedness of humanity and environment.
- Color Palette & Texture: The artist’s deliberate use of color palettes—often incorporating muted greens, browns, and golds—reflects the aesthetic ideals of shan shui. Furthermore, she meticulously crafts textures through layering silk threads and applying dyes, creating a tactile surface that enhances the viewer's sensory experience.
